Nalaih is a princess of a kingdom that is on the verge of destruction. A long list of traditions that the nobles hold to, yet their people hate, spending money on party wine and dress and with a rebellion, against nobles and the royal family, that itself is corrupted. How will the next court, the group of teenagers meant to take over the kingdom after the court death deal with it. Two words, they aren't. At least that's what the court thinks when they send them away. They though have no clue that three of the next court are actively working against them. Save their bastardized children and protecting the abused lovers of their parents. One of those three being the leader of the group that just want the nobles to care and the kingdom to run. A child who had the chance to be born in love and not be a bastard. Above all though the shelter princess just wants to protect her friend but can she do that with a enemy under her nose, maybe with the help of a rebels son? ~~~~ This will include characters that are a part of lgbt+ community the main character is not or not stated as such.
